威尔一头扎进了家具制作, 他开始采购硬木,但很快发现通常很难买到. 他开始和自己锯木头的社区成员一起工作,不久之后, 他有机会在2020年购买自己的锯木厂. 这使威尔能够找到风暴期间掉落的日志, trees that were destroyed by pests (including ash trees which have been destroyed by the Emerald Ash Borer across Virginia and other states) and trees that people were having removed and would otherwise have been burned. 在这一点上,威尔开始看到这个行业有很大的潜力. 

“I started milling and realized that there was a whole lot of interest in the wood that I was milling in addition to the furniture that I was making,威尔想。. 他开始出售自己从这些打捞上来的硬木木材, 大多是倒下或不需要的树木,需求量很大. 

随着需求的增加,对一个更大的锯木厂的需求也在增加. 威尔开始寻找产能更大的锯木厂,但需要一个地方来安置锯木厂, 于是他转向他的朋友, 泰勒皮平. 泰勒 is a farmer who offered to house the larger mill on his property to help Will in his endeavors. 当威尔在疫情最严重的时候,他在研究一个更大的锯木厂的选择, he learned the wait times were tremendous (upwards of one to two years) and financing options were slim from traditional banks. 会的朋友, 泰勒, has been a Farm Credit customer-owner since he was 22 and suggested Will reach out to the cooperative. 威尔给夏洛茨维尔分部打过电话吗, explained that he was looking to purchase a used sawmill (pictured below) and Farm Credit made it happen.

Will credits the speed of financing he received from Farm Credit in the summer of 2023 as being key to his operation and being able to get up and running with the new sawmill. 在买下他的新锯木厂之后, 威尔有能力锯长21英尺的原木,切出48英寸的切口, whereas he could only mill logs that were 14 feet long and make 21 inch cuts with his original mill. 新工厂也是可移动的, so Will and 泰勒 can take it to farms or other rural properties to pick up the timber where it is.

弗吉尼亚锯木厂用材

“I’m pretty passionate about sustainably harvested hardwoods and taking the wood through its lifecycle from log to living room,威尔说. 他喜欢带着他的客户一起旅行, 告诉他们树是从哪里来的, 是什么物种, 为什么它会下来,然后分享切割的过程, 用电吹风, 窑干,最后加工,创造他们的梦想的桌子或橱柜. 该公司的业务分为Wm旗下的定制委托家具. 沃克有限公司. 标签和锯木过程, 其中包括向其他家具制造商和木工销售木材, 属于大熊木材公司吗, 威尔和泰勒的合作关系. 定制家具需要更长的时间才能完成, so the lumber sales originated as a way to make supplemental income during the longer build process of the custom furniture (which can take 14-16 weeks in a perfect scenario, 从地上的树到家里的桌子). 然而, the hardwoods Will harvests and mills have become so popular that those projects now take up about 60% of his time, 而海关佣金约占40%. 

Will works with a local friend and fellow sawyer to source other sustainably harvested lumber for his custom commissioned projects when he can’t meet those needs with his own supply. His friend also has a kiln where the lumber is dried to the correct moisture content and then stored on the property in an old barn that has been retrofitted as a wood storage facility. 硬木在整个干燥过程中价值增加, 所以木板干燥的时间越长, 它就越有价值, 在理论上. 

通过在木工社区的网络, Will找到了对不同产品感兴趣的不同买家, 新鲜切的, 绿色木材到一件完整的家具. Will has repeat customers who return time and time again because they value the quality of the lumber. 威尔和泰勒未来的计划包括建造他们自己的窑炉, storage outbuildings and retail barn to serve as a showroom when clients visit to pick out wood for furniture pieces or to purchase for their own projects.

Will shared, “Right now I’m working on a solid walnut dining table for a couple in Charlottesville. 他们可以出来捡木材, 当我们切桌面的木板时, 我们把它们按顺序排列. 所以当你打开它, 这就是所谓的“书本比赛”,这意味着木头会在桌面上反射自己.”
